Dovitinib in BCG Refractory Urothelial Carcinoma With FGFR3 Mutations or Over-expression

Stopped early · Phase 2

Conditions studied: Bladder Cancer

In brief

This trial will assess the 6-month complete response rate and toxicity profile of oral dovitinib therapy in BCG-refractory urothelial carcinoma patients with tumors with FGFR3 mutations or over-expression who are ineligible for or refusing cystectomy.
